The Weather Factor

Scottsdale averages more than 300 sunny days per year. That means a private pool is not just a luxury here — it is a genuine highlight of the experience. Even during the cooler winter months, afternoon temperatures often climb into the 70s. Therefore, pool season in Scottsdale lasts far longer than almost anywhere else in the country.

Spring and fall are especially popular. The weather is warm but not extreme, making outdoor time genuinely enjoyable. Summer brings intense heat, but that is exactly when a private pool becomes your best friend after a day of exploring.

Tips for Booking a Private Pool Home in Old Town Scottsdale

Timing your booking is important, especially for a high-demand destination like Old Town Scottsdale. Here are a few practical tips to keep in mind.

Book Early for Peak Seasons

Scottsdale’s most popular travel windows fill up fast. Spring training season — typically late February through March — brings thousands of baseball fans to the area. Additionally, major events like the Barrett-Jackson car auction and the WM Phoenix Open in January and February push demand even higher. If your travel dates fall near any of these events, booking several months in advance is a smart move.

Fall and winter are also increasingly popular as travelers escape colder climates. Therefore, do not assume availability will be easy to find during those months either.
